ICC Women’s Player of the Month for March 2025 revealed
Australia’s newest batting sensation takes home the ICC Women’s Player of the Month for March 2025.
Georgia Voll, who made her international debut in December of last year, took home the honour for the ICC Women’s Player of the Month for March 2025. Voll beat competition from senior compatriot Annabel Sutherland and USA’s Chetnaa Prasad.
The 21-year-old played a crucial role in Australia's 3-0 whitewash of the White Ferns in March.
Voll helped the team by providing confident starts along with the experienced Beth Mooney at the other end, finishing second in the run-scoring charts (161 runs) behind her opening partner.

Voll began with a 50 off 31 deliveries in the opening game, before a quickfire 36 off 20 in the second T20I, and wrapped up the series with a career-high 75 off 57 in the final game.
Voll’s success means that Australian players have won the monthly award for the fourth month in a row, with Annabel Sutherland bagging it in December 2024 followed by Beth Mooney in January and Alan King in February.
Elated at being named the Player of the Month, Voll said: "Winning this award is certainly a nice way to cap off what's been an incredible summer for myself and the team.
"To go to New Zealand and claim that T20 series against the World Champions was the perfect way to end the season. It's been a whirlwind first summer in the Australian side and I'm excited for what next season holds."
